Just days before Cheyenne Ward was to enter the second grade her life ended in a house fire in Jackson Township.

According to communications records the fire in the house on U.S. 50 where Cheyenne lived with her grandmother Stella Ward and her two older brothers broke out some time around 11 p.m. Thursday, Aug. 26. The communications describe neighbors’ efforts to help Stella Ward off the roof after she climbed out a window.

When firefighters arrived on the scene the home was fully engulfed. They were told Cheyenne was still in the building and rushed in to retrieve her from her bedroom. By the time they got to her she was unresponsive and was rushed by Williamsburg EMS to the Clermont Northeastern campus when AirCare responders pronounced her dead at the scene.
